What Makes This Pacemaker Revolutionary?

The device used, an ultra-advanced capsule pacemaker like the AVEIR system, represents a major leap forward in medical technology.

  • Leadless and Minimally Invasive: Unlike conventional pacemakers that require a surgical incision in the chest and thin wires (leads) connected to the heart, this device is about the size of a vitamin capsule. It is guided directly into the heart through a vein in the groin using a catheter, leaving no chest scar or “pacemaker bump.”
  • Retrievable Design: A key innovation is the device’s ability to be safely retrieved or replaced if needed. This eliminates long-term complications associated with leads, such as infection, wire fracture, or the need for complex extraction procedures decades later.
  • Dual-Chamber Functionality: The system is designed to provide dual-chamber pacing, which is required by the majority of patients. It can be initially implanted as a single chamber and later upgraded wirelessly to a dual-chamber system, ensuring flexibility for the patient’s future health needs.
